AI x HR Conference 2026: Stagnation or Breakthrough?



Overview


On January 28, 2026, from 10:00 AM to 6:10 PM, the AI x HR Conference 2026 will be held online. Organized by RYOMA, this event aims to address the pressing issues in human resources amid the rapid advancements in artificial intelligence. Under the theme "Stagnation or Breakthrough?", this conference will feature 12 comprehensive sessions with a total of 24 speakers, focusing on how AI can transform hiring, training, evaluations, retention, and human capital management.

The Need for Change in HR


The challenges facing HR today are multifaceted: recruitment difficulties, early turnover, skills revitalization, and the complexities of human capital management. The advent of generative AI and data utilization adds another layer of urgency to these issues. Organizations now face a crucial choice: will they remain stagnant, relying on traditional methods, or will they embrace strategic innovations powered by AI to redefine their future?

This conference is designed not just as a theoretical discussion but as a practical workshop where HR professionals can gain actionable insights on decision-making frameworks and real-world implementation strategies.

Session Line-up (12 Sessions)


1. The Future of AI x HR - Speakers: Kuroda, Yasuda
2. Emotional Intelligence and AI in Hiring - Speakers: Junya Ogino (Mindful Leadership Institute), Asaka, Miho Iijima (Emotional Technologies)
3. Breaking Media Dependency in Recruitment - Speakers: Naoya Minezaki (en Japan Inc.), Itsuki Yoshino (You Trust Inc.)
4. Work Allocation Between AI and Humans - Speakers: Yoshitaka Handa (Exawizards Inc.), Shigihiro Sunada (PeopleX)
5. New Norms in Recruitment Marketing - Speakers: Michio Ochi (Midas Inc.), Akikazu Kiriyama (Rilo Club Inc.)
6. Science of Onboarding - Speakers: Teppei Yamamoto (Plus Alpha Consulting), Keishu Otaki (Leverages Inc.)
7. Special Lecture on Evaluation Systems - Speakers: Ikeura, Asaka
8. Skill Mapping and Reskilling - Speakers: Yoko Aigami (Kakedas Inc.), Tomoya Tajima (manebi Inc.)
9. Quantifying Engagement and Well-being - Speakers: Takakuni Omote (Mitsukari Inc.), Emi Minagawa (KAKEAI Inc.)
10. Practicing Human Capital Management - Speakers: Hiroaki Mori (NEWONE Inc.), Yuzo Hashimoto (RECOMO Inc.)
11. Efficiency in Recruiting Operations - Speakers: Sohei Ryogaku (Wantedly Inc.), Kaname Fukazawa (Japan AI Inc.)
12. Strengthening Retention with AI and Management - Speakers: Takuya Okimoto (Yum Technology Japan), Yuko Hayashi (Persol Innovation)
